swedish and the "sh" sound

the sound that swedish finns pronounce "sh", and which is spelled in a variety of ways (eg stj, sj, kj, sk), is pronounced really adorably by proper swedes, with a little whistly noise, sort of like a cross between a "h" and "s" and "w".
